Subject: Re: devpts mounts too slowly
Alexey Vlasov wrote:
> On Mon, Jul 06, 2009 at 02:21:51PM -0700, H. Peter Anvin wrote:
>> Do you have /selinux mounted on one of them?
>
> I don't use SELinux anywhere.
>
That's, apparently, the problem: some version of the mount binary will
search all of /proc/mounts for selinux if it isn't mounted on /selinux.
This is a serious performance bug, obviously.
